Vinyl Film Market Outlook

The global vinyl film market is projected to reach approximately USD 19.6 billion by 2035,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 5.8% from 2025 to 2035. This substantial growth is attributed to the increasing adoption of vinyl films in diverse applications such as automotive, architectural, and advertising sectors, where aesthetics and durability are critical. Furthermore, the rising demand for custom graphics and vehicle wraps is propelling this market, as businesses look for cost-effective solutions to enhance their branding and visual appeal. The expansion of the e-commerce sector is also contributing to market growth, making vinyl films more accessible to a wider audience. Additionally, innovations in vinyl film technology, including improved adhesive capabilities and weather resistance, are expected to boost market penetration and consumer acceptance.

By Product Type

Vinyl Wrap Films:

Vinyl wrap films are increasingly popular due to their versatility and the ability to cover large surfaces with ease. These films are used primarily in the automotive sector for color changes and protective overlays, allowing consumers to personalize their vehicles without the need for permanent paint. They offer a variety of finishes, including gloss, matte, and satin, which appeals to different aesthetic preferences. In addition to automotive applications, vinyl wrap films are also utilized in commercial advertising, enabling businesses to transform vehicle fleets into mobile billboards. The growth in the vinyl wrap segment is also fueled by advancements in application techniques, which have made it easier and more efficient to install these films.

Vinyl Graphic Films:

Vinyl graphic films are specifically designed for use in high-quality graphics and signage applications, making them essential in the advertising and promotions industry. These films are available in a wide range of colors and finishes, providing businesses with the flexibility to create eye-catching graphics that stand out in competitive markets. Their durability and UV resistance make them ideal for outdoor applications, ensuring longevity and vibrancy even under harsh weather conditions. Moreover, the ability to print detailed images and designs onto vinyl graphic films through digital printing technology enhances their appeal, allowing for customization that meets unique branding requirements.

Vinyl Lettering Films:

Vinyl lettering films are widely used for creating precise lettering and logos for signage, vehicle graphics, and promotional materials. These films are easy to cut and apply, making them a favorite among small businesses and individuals looking to create custom signage. Their adhesive properties allow them to stick effectively to various surfaces, including glass, plastic, and metal, ensuring visibility and durability. The growing trend towards DIY projects and personalized branding solutions among entrepreneurs and small businesses has led to an increase in demand for vinyl lettering films, as these products offer an affordable and customizable option for effective communication.

Vinyl Sticker Films:

The vinyl sticker films segment is seeing significant growth, fueled by the popularity of custom stickers and decals in both consumer and business applications. These films can be produced in a variety of shapes, sizes, and finishes, allowing for creative branding options. The rise of social media platforms and trends in personal expression has encouraged consumers to seek unique sticker designs for personal use, such as laptop decals, phone covers, and home decorations. Businesses are also leveraging vinyl sticker films for promotional giveaways and marketing campaigns, which has further expanded the market. Additionally, advancements in adhesive technology have improved the ease of application and removability of stickers, making them more appealing to consumers.

Vinyl Printing Films:

Vinyl printing films are essential for businesses that require high-quality printed graphics for branding and marketing purposes. These films are compatible with various printing technologies, allowing for detailed images, logos, and messages to be printed directly onto the film. The demand for vinyl printing films is soaring as businesses look to enhance their marketing materials, signage, and promotional items with vibrant, eye-catching designs. The rise of digital printing has also made it easier for small businesses to access high-quality vinyl printing solutions without substantial upfront investment. Moreover, the ability to print on-demand allows for greater flexibility and customization, catering to the unique needs of different industries.

By Application

Automotive:

The automotive sector is one of the largest consumers of vinyl films, primarily for vehicle wraps and protection. Consumers are increasingly drawn to vinyl films for personalization, allowing for color changes and custom designs without the permanence of paint. Additionally, vinyl films serve a protective function, guarding the vehicle's original paint from scratches, UV rays, and other environmental factors. This dual functionality is appealing to car enthusiasts and everyday drivers alike, leading to a steady increase in demand. Furthermore, car manufacturers are incorporating vinyl films into their offerings, recognizing their potential for branding and aesthetics, which is anticipated to further boost market growth in this application.

Architectural:

In the architectural realm, vinyl films are utilized for a variety of applications including window films, wall coverings, and decorative elements. These films contribute to energy efficiency by reducing heat gain and glare, making them a popular choice among architects and builders focusing on sustainability. Additionally, vinyl films allow for creative expression in interior design, as they are available in numerous colors and patterns. The growing trend of using decorative films for both residential and commercial spaces signifies an expanding market, especially as more consumers and businesses prioritize aesthetics alongside functionality in their environments.

Marine:

The use of vinyl films in the marine industry is gaining traction, particularly for boat wraps and protective coverings. These films provide an easy way to customize and protect vessels from the elements, such as saltwater, UV exposure, and physical damage. The durability and weather resistance of vinyl films make them a popular choice among boat owners who seek to maintain the appearance and integrity of their vessels. Additionally, the opportunity for branding in the marine sector is increasing, as businesses are leveraging boat wraps for advertising their services, which is further propelling demand in this application.

Advertising & Promotions:

Advertising and promotions represent a significant application for vinyl films, as businesses utilize them for a wide range of marketing materials, including banners, signage, and point-of-purchase displays. The versatility of vinyl films allows for impactful designs that can capture attention and convey messages effectively. As businesses increasingly shift towards visually-driven marketing strategies, the demand for vinyl films in this sector is expected to grow. Moreover, the ease of printing on vinyl films has enabled companies to create short-run promotional materials quickly and affordably, catering to changing marketing trends and consumer preferences.

Packaging:

Vinyl films are increasingly being adopted in the packaging industry due to their aesthetic appeal and functionality. These films can enhance the visual presentation of products while also providing durability and protection during shipping and handling. The growing trend toward personalized packaging solutions has driven the demand for vinyl films, as brands seek to differentiate themselves in crowded marketplaces. Furthermore, the ability to print vibrant designs and labels on vinyl films makes them an attractive option for businesses looking to elevate their packaging aesthetics and communicate their brand identity effectively.

By Material Type

Polyvinyl Chloride (PVC):

Polyvinyl chloride (PVC) is the most widely used material for vinyl films, owing to its versatility and durability. PVC films are utilized in a range of applications, including automotive wraps, architectural finishes, and signage. Their excellent weather resistance and ability to hold vibrant colors make them suitable for both indoor and outdoor use. The PVC segment is experiencing growth as manufacturers innovate with formulations that enhance flexibility and adhesion properties, catering to a diverse range of consumer needs. Moreover, the recyclability of PVC films aligns with the increasing consumer demand for sustainable materials, further supporting their market position.

Polyethylene (PE):

Polyethylene (PE) is another material type gaining traction in the vinyl film market, primarily known for its lightweight and cost-effective properties. PE films are often used in packaging applications due to their excellent moisture resistance and clarity. Their ability to be produced in various thicknesses makes them suitable for a range of applications, from protective wraps to decorative films. The growing emphasis on sustainable packaging solutions is driving demand for PE films, as they can be produced from recycled materials and are often recyclable themselves. As regulations around packaging sustainability become stricter, the preference for polyethylene films is expected to increase.

Polypropylene (PP):

Polypropylene (PP) is noted for its strength and resistance to chemical exposure, making it an appealing choice for vinyl films in various applications. This material is commonly used in packaging, labels, and signage, where durability and print quality are essential. The PP segment is expected to grow as businesses increasingly prioritize high-performance materials that can withstand environmental stressors. Additionally, innovations in printing technology allow for high-resolution graphics and vibrant colors on PP films, enhancing their appeal for promotional and advertising purposes.

Polyethylene Terephthalate (PET):

Polyethylene terephthalate (PET) is recognized for its exceptional clarity, strength, and resistance to impact, making it a valuable material for vinyl films in the packaging and decorative sectors. PET films can provide a premium look and feel, which is particularly appealing for high-end consumer products. The demand for PET films is on the rise as industries seek lightweight, durable, and visually appealing packaging solutions. With the continuous trend towards sustainability, PET’s recyclability is also contributing to its growing preference, aligning with consumer expectations for eco-friendly products.

By Polyvinyl Chloride

Flexible PVC Films:

Flexible PVC films are widely employed in various applications due to their excellent adaptability and ease of processing. These films are particularly valuable in the automotive and architectural sectors, where they can be easily molded into different shapes and sizes. Their flexibility allows for intricate designs and applications, making them a popular choice for custom graphics and decor. The ability to withstand extreme temperatures and environmental conditions further enhances their use in outdoor applications, driving demand in the market. The increasing trend towards personalization and customization in various industries is expected to bolster the growth of flexible PVC films.

Rigid PVC Films:

Rigid PVC films are commonly used for products requiring structural integrity and durability. This material is found in a variety of applications, including signage, packaging, and construction materials. Rigid PVC films are known for their high-impact resistance and ability to maintain shape, making them suitable for use in environments where stability is critical. The growth in commercial and residential construction sectors is likely to drive demand for rigid PVC films, as they are often used in window frames, doors, and other building components. Additionally, advancements in technology are enhancing the performance characteristics of rigid PVC films, making them more appealing to manufacturers and end-users alike.

By Polyethylene

Low-Density Polyethylene (LDPE):

Low-density polyethylene (LDPE) is recognized for its flexibility and toughness, making it an ideal material for a range of applications. LDPE films are commonly used in packaging solutions, protective covers, and shrink wraps due to their excellent moisture and impact resistance. The demand for LDPE films is being driven by the rise in e-commerce, where protective packaging plays a critical role in ensuring product safety during shipping. Additionally, the ability to produce LDPE films in various thicknesses allows for versatility across applications, further supporting their market growth.

High-Density Polyethylene (HDPE):

High-density polyethylene (HDPE) films are celebrated for their strength and durability, providing excellent resistance to punctures and tears. These films are commonly used in industrial applications, including packaging for heavy products, agricultural films, and geomembranes. The increasing focus on sustainable practices in manufacturing and packaging is propelling the demand for HDPE films, as they can be made from recycled materials and are themselves recyclable. As industries seek more robust and eco-friendly packaging solutions, the HDPE segment of the vinyl film market is expected to grow steadily.

By Polypropylene

Oriented Polypropylene (OPP):

Oriented polypropylene (OPP) films are known for their high strength and clarity, making them ideal for packaging applications where visibility and presentation are crucial. OPP films are widely used for food packaging, labels, and promotional materials due to their excellent barrier properties against moisture and gases. The demand for OPP films is on the rise as consumer preferences shift towards visually appealing and protective packaging solutions. Furthermore, advancements in printing technology allow for high-quality graphics on OPP films, enhancing their effectiveness in advertising and branding.

Cast Polypropylene (CPP):

Cast polypropylene (CPP) films are recognized for their flexibility and transparency, making them suitable for a variety of packaging applications. CPP films are often used for food packaging, as they provide excellent sealing properties while maintaining product freshness. The growth of the food and beverage industry is driving demand for CPP films, particularly in convenience packaging. Additionally, CPP films are increasingly being adopted in the production of gift wrap and labels, showcasing their versatility across different sectors. As the demand for innovative packaging solutions rises, the CPP segment is expected to expand significantly.

By Polyethylene Terephthalate

PET Film:

Polyethylene terephthalate (PET) film is widely used in packaging and labeling applications due to its excellent clarity, strength, and resistance to impact. PET films are particularly favored in the beverage and food industries for their ability to maintain quality and extend shelf life. The demand for PET films is increasing as brands seek sustainable packaging solutions that align with consumer expectations for eco-friendly products. As recycling initiatives gain traction, the ability to recycle PET films is also enhancing their market appeal, ensuring continuous growth in this segment.

By Region

Geographically, the vinyl film market is witnessing robust growth across various regions, with North America and Europe being significant contributors. North America is expected to dominate the market, accounting for approximately 35% of the total share by 2035, driven by the high adoption of vinyl films in the automotive and architectural sectors. The increasing trend of vehicle customization, coupled with rising demand for energy-efficient building solutions, is propelling the growth of vinyl films in this region. Furthermore, the presence of key players and technological advancements in vinyl film manufacturing are expected to further enhance market dynamics, with a projected CAGR of 6.5% during the forecast period.

In contrast, the Asia Pacific region is emerging as a promising market for vinyl films, anticipated to grow at a CAGR of 7.2% between 2025 and 2035. The rapid expansion of the automotive industry, coupled with increasing disposable income among consumers, is driving demand for vinyl films in countries such as China, India, and Japan. Additionally, the rising emphasis on customized packaging solutions in the region's burgeoning e-commerce sector is expected to contribute significantly to market growth. As more businesses recognize the benefits of utilizing vinyl films for branding and advertising purposes, the Asia Pacific region is poised for substantial growth in the coming years.

Threats

Despite the promising outlook for the vinyl film market, several threats could impede growth. One of the primary challenges is the increasing competition from alternative materials and emerging technologies. As industries explore eco-friendly options, competitors such as biodegradable films and other sustainable packaging solutions may present a formidable challenge to traditional vinyl films. This shift in consumer preferences toward sustainability could result in reduced demand for vinyl films unless manufacturers adapt and innovate accordingly. Additionally, fluctuations in raw material prices, particularly for PVC and other polymers, can affect production costs and profit margins, posing a threat to manufacturers operating in this space.

Another key concern is the potential for regulatory changes surrounding plastic use and waste management. As environmental awareness grows, governments worldwide are implementing stricter regulations regarding the production and disposal of plastic products. If vinyl films are classified under stringent regulations, manufacturers may face challenges in compliance, leading to increased costs and operational complications. Companies must stay agile and informed about regulatory developments to mitigate these risks effectively. Furthermore, maintaining consumer trust and brand reputation is crucial in a market where sustainability is becoming a significant factor in purchasing decisions; any negative publicity related to environmental impact can adversely affect sales and long-term growth.
